The series finale, Things Change , is controversial. It does not resolve the Beast Boy/Terra cliffhanger. Instead, it suggests that sometimes people move on, and heroes don't always get closure. It was a bold, unsatisfying narrative choice that has haunted fans for two decades. 2003SerieLos jovenes titanes
